Sake rice is usually polished to the Significantly bigger diploma than normal table rice. The rationale for sprucing is a result of the composition and structure in the rice grain by itself. The Main with the rice grain is full of starch, even though the outer levels of your grain contain greater concentrations of fats, vitamins, and proteins. Considering that an increased focus of Extra fat and protein during the sake would lead to off-flavors and contribute tough factors on the sake, the outer layers in the sake rice grain is milled away inside a polishing process, leaving just the starchy Element of the grain (some sake brewers remove over sixty% of your rice grain in the sprucing system).

Brewers Categorical polishing as a proportion of the grain remaining. So a rice polishing ratio of sixty% usually means the brewer taken out forty% of your outer grain. A ratio of fifty% indicates fifty percent the grain is absent. Lower numbers signify more polishing, and sometimes additional delicacy in the final solution.

Genshu (原酒) Most sake is diluted with water right before bottling to deliver alcohol material down to around fifteen%. Genshu skips that dilution action. Liquor material ranges from 17% to twenty%. The flavor is a lot more concentrated and extreme. Some people like it. Other people discover it frustrating in the beginning.

In the course of this era, Repeated all-natural disasters and undesirable temperature brought on rice shortages, plus the Tokugawa shogunate issued sake brewing limits sixty one occasions.[twenty five] Inside the early Edo interval, there was a sake choshuya brewing approach known as shiki jōzō (四季醸造) which was optimized for every period. In 1667, the system of kanzukuri (寒造り) for creating sake in Winter season was improved, As well as in 1673, once the Tokugawa shogunate banned brewing besides kanzukuri as a result of a lack of rice, choshuya the method of sake brewing from the 4 seasons ceased, and it became prevalent to create sake only in Winter season until industrial technology started to create during the twentieth century.
